ORDER:

This Writ Petition is filed for a Mandamus to declare the auction notification, dated 23.12.2015, of respondent No.4 as illegal and arbitrary.

At the hearing, Mr. K.R.Prabhakar, learned Standing Counsel for respondent No.4, submitted that auction was already held in pursuance of the auction notification and that either the petitioners or their benamis have emerged as the highest bidders.

Mr. Vedula Venkatramana, learned senior counsel

appearing for the petitioners, requested for permission of the Court to withdraw the Writ Petition with liberty to his clients to file a fresh Writ Petition in the event they feel aggrieved by the action of respondent No.4.

The Writ Petition is, accordingly, dismissed as withdrawn with liberty to the petitioners in terms of the prayer made.

As a sequel to dismissal of the Writ Petition, WPMP.No.1657 of 2016 shall stand dismissed as infructuous.
